True bugs (Order: Hemiptera) (iv) Spined soldier bug ( Podisus maculiventris) Although many stink bugs are plant-feeding pests, the spined soldier bug is an excellent predator found in a variety of crop habitats, including orchards, vegetables, and row crops. WebNov 22, 2024 · Adult spined soldier bugs are shaped like a shield and are approximately 0.4-0.6 in (1.1-1.5 cm) in length. They have two wings, and along with that wing, the abdomen is marked with dark and bright colored spots. The insect name spined soldier comes from its outward extending spine at the back of its head.

WebThe spined soldier bug is a predaceous stink bug, feeding on numerous pests in all field crops (fig. 8). While it usually has pointed shoulders, its most characteristic feature is a long, pointed abdominal spine between its legs. Nymphs are a dark red with black heads, with later instars tan to orange with red and white stripes on the abdomen. ... WebLadybug. Photo by D. Shetlar.
